.team-member{margin-bottom:30px;position:relative}.team-member .img-container:after{background:rgba(0,16,130,.8);bottom:0;content:"";left:0;opacity:0;position:absolute;right:0;top:0;transition:opacity .3s ease;z-index:1}@media only screen and (min-width:1024px){.team-member:hover .img-container:after{opacity:1}}@media only screen and (max-width:1023px){.team-member:focus .img-container:after,.team-member:hover .img-container:after{display:none}}.team-member span{color:#fff;font-size:14px;font-weight:700;left:50%;line-height:20px;position:absolute;right:0;text-align:center;top:50%;transform:translateY(-50%) translateX(-50%);visibility:hidden;z-index:2}@media only screen and (min-width:1024px){.team-member:hover span{visibility:visible}}.team-member-info{text-align:center}.team-member-name{margin:0}.team-member-name a{color:#3a3a3a;font-size:20px;font-weight:700;line-height:28px;text-decoration:none}.team-member a:after{bottom:0;content:"";left:0;position:absolute;right:0;top:0;z-index:2}.team-member-title{font-size:14px;font-weight:300;line-height:20px;margin:8px 0 0}@media screen (min-width:900px){.team-member-name a{font-size:20px;line-height:28px}}.modal{align-items:center;bottom:0;flex-direction:column;justify-content:center;left:0;opacity:0;overflow:hidden;position:fixed;right:0;top:0;transition:opacity .3s;z-index:-1}.modal-content-wrapper{background:#fff;box-shadow:0 4px 10px rgba(0,16,130,.1);margin:0 auto;max-width:608px;padding:8px;z-index:40}.modal-content{padding:14px 16px 16px}@media only screen and (max-width:899px){.modal-content{height:calc(100vh - 50px);overflow-y:scroll}}.modal.is-active{display:flex;opacity:1;z-index:999}.modal-background{backdrop-filter:blur(4px);background:rgba(25,25,25,.5);bottom:0;left:0;position:absolute;right:0;top:0}.close-button-wrapper{cursor:pointer;display:flex;justify-content:flex-end;margin-right:8px;margin-top:16px}.modal-content .row-fluid{align-items:end}.modal-content .team-member-name{color:#191919;font-size:24px;font-weight:600;line-height:36px}.modal-content .team-member-title{font-size:16px;font-weight:300;line-height:24px}.modal-content .text-wrapper{margin-top:40px}